I've had problems with having multiple dbwriters under solaris 2.3. The database comes up ok, but if you try to do anything that updates the control file, like adding a file to a tablespace, or dropping a tablespace, the database writers seem to trip over themselves trying to update the control file.
I have set db_writers = 1 and async_write=true. I've been told that the async_write is equivalent to having multiple database writers.
